Ownership of content at Zero 2 Infinity[edit]

Your edits reflect a misunderstanding of the purpose of Wikipedia. Wikipedia is a collaborative encyclopedia; companies do not control the content that appears on their pages. Additionally, you appear to have a conflict of interest regarding the article; I would advise you to propose further changes on the talk page using Template:Edit request instead of editing it directly. For further information, please read Wikipedia's conflict of interest guideline, our ownership of content policy, and if you are being paid for your contributions by the subject, our policy on paid editors TeraTIX 13:16, 17 July 2018 (UTC)[reply]
